@tedanderson: I agree with fiadmimedia, seems to me like you might be stretching the boundaries of your hardware on this one. Quadcore processors can be had on the cheap anymore, but judging by the fact your running a Celeron, it's unlikely you'll have an LGA 775 socket or newer motherboard. While it's not impossible, it appears some of the faster Celeron's do infact use the LGA 775 socket.
I tend to be Bias towards Intel, so I'd suggest something like the Intel Core 2 Q8200 @ 2.33GHz. It's a rather cost effective processor and would run you about $150. Personally I'd try starting from scratch if you can get the budget for it.
As far as your program concerns go, check out Wirecast, it will do exactly what you want it to, and record in different formats and bit-rates from the same source. Only catch is that it's not exactly a cheap program. |
